Pier 14 Fender Upgrades

A long concrete pier extends over calm water with industrial structures, cranes, and tanks visible in the background under a clear blue sky.

Pier 14 in Newport News, VA, was recently acquired by Riverport LLC to support ship repairs. Pier 14 did not have adequate fenders or overall lateral capacity for berthing loads.
